400+ People Arrested
 in National Sting 

On Tuesday, August 30, Attorney General Alberto R. Gonzales announced the results of a nationwide effort – Operation Wildfire – to fight Meth.  The Drug Enforcement Administration led a combined law enforcement effort of local, state and federal authorities in 200 cities across the United States to snare Meth manufacturers and users.  427 people were arrested; 208 pounds of Meth were seized and 524 pounds of precursor materials were confiscated.  The feds estimate the seized materials would have made enough Meth to provide 284,00 people a hit.  Read the entire transcript of Gonzales’ speech here.
